I have a partial sphere, 2" diameter. The grinding isnt right and caused a visable circular mark which is verified using a Mic. Is there a way to show the variance of the actual hits compared to a theoretically perfect 2" sphere.
Assuming he sets the sphere as origin for his reporting alignment, he should be able to report each hit just with a T-value via feature location. The value will be the deviation from perfect with the centroid as origin, which may be of more direct use than actual distance. Maybe.
